扫描打开手机站
m.zqcyzg.com
随时逛,更方便
当前位置:首页 > 科技问答 >

怎么查看mysql的版本,快速查看MySQL版本的几种实用方法

来源:创新科技网(www.zqcyzg.com时间:2025-07-18 16:18作者:ASANA手机阅读>>

最快捷的方式是在终端或CMD中直接运行mysql --versionmysql -V(注意V大写),无需登录数据库即可返回版本信息,例如输出“mysql Ver 8.0.32 for Linux”。这一方法适用于所有操作系统,尤其适合运维人员快速验证环境配置。若已配置MySQL环境变量但命令无效,可能是路径未包含或服务未启动,需检查安装目录的bin文件夹是否加入系统PATH。

2、登录MySQL后执行SQL

怎么查看mysql的版本,快速查看MySQL版本的几种实用方法

若需获取更详细的版本信息(如编译环境),可在登录MySQL后执行SQL语句。推荐使用SELECT VERSION;SELECT @@VERSION;,两者均返回简洁版本号(如“8.0.23”)。而SHOW VARIABLES LIKE '%version%';会展示版本相关的所有系统变量,包括编译操作系统和机器架构等扩展信息,适合开发者排查兼容性问题。

3、图形化工具查看

怎么查看mysql的版本,快速查看MySQL版本的几种实用方法

使用MySQL Workbench、phpMyAdmin等GUI工具时,版本通常显示在连接状态栏或服务器信息面板。例如Workbench中,点击“Server Status”即可在“Version”字段查看;phpMyAdmin的首页右下角也会标注“Server version”。此方法适合不熟悉命令行的用户,且能同步获取服务器运行状态和资源使用情况。

4、系统服务与配置文件

通过服务状态命令可间接获取版本:Linux系统运行systemctl status mysql,Windows使用sc query mysql,输出中会包含版本标识。MySQL配置文件(如Linux的/etc/mysql/f或Windows的my.ini)也可能内嵌版本信息,但需注意部分配置可能被注释或需结合datadir路径下的日志文件交叉验证。创新科技网 wWw.zQCYZG.CoM

5、编程语言调用API

开发者可通过代码集成查询,例如PHP的$mysqli->server_info、Python的mysql.connector.connect.get_server_info或Java JDBC的DatabaseMetaData.getDatabaseProductVersion。这类方法适合需要动态检测版本的自动化脚本或应用,但需确保数据库连接权限和依赖库正确配置。

科技问答排行